Abstract

The combination of innovative pedagogy and machine learning algorithms presents transformative possibilities in the age of individualized education. This chapter explores the process of creating machine learning-enhanced personalized learning scenarios. It also looks at how intelligent pedagogy is built on the careful selection of learner activities, appropriate pedagogical approaches, and objectives. This chapter also includes a thoughtful case study that illustrates how these ideas are applied in the actual world. It has been demonstrated that the use of machine learning algorithms transforms remediation, assessment, and feedback while promoting a dynamic and adaptable learning environment. Through analyzing the effective application of machine learning in a real-world setting, teachers can acquire important knowledge about how to use these tools to maximize learning outcomes and give students more agency.

Education has traditionally followed a one-size-fits-all approach, where a standardized curriculum and teaching methods are applied uniformly to a diverse student population (Vygotsky, 1978). However, this conventional model often falls short in catering to the unique strengths, weaknesses, and learning styles of individual students (Anderson & Dron, 2011). In today's world, where the educational landscape is characterized by a diverse and interconnected global society, personalized education emerges as a critical solution to bridge the gaps and unlock the full potential of learners.

Personalized education acknowledges that each student is unique, with distinct abilities, interests, and needs. By tailoring the learning experience to suit these individual characteristics, personalized education not only enhances student engagement but also improves learning outcomes. It fosters a deeper understanding of subject matter, encourages critical thinking, and nurtures a lifelong love for learning (Zhao et al., 2002). Moreover, in an era of rapid technological advancements, personalized education equips students with the skills and adaptability needed to thrive in an ever-changing job market.

Machine learning algorithms have emerged as a powerful tool in reshaping education (Siemens & Baker, 2012). These algorithms can analyze vast amounts of data on student behavior, performance, and preferences, allowing educators to gain valuable insights into individual learning patterns. By leveraging this data, machine learning algorithms can recommend tailored content, adaptive assessments, and personalized learning pathways for each student.

Machine learning algorithms also enable the automation of administrative tasks, freeing up educators to focus more on individualized instruction and mentorship. They can identify early signs of student struggles and provide timely interventions to prevent learning gaps from widening. Additionally, these algorithms facilitate continuous improvement in educational materials and methods, ensuring that the content remains relevant and effective.
